Title :
Effects analysis of I/Q imbalance on the multi-antenna receiving systems

Abstract :
In this paper we present the effects analysis of the imperfections for practical high speed wireless multi-antenna transceiving systems. Some integration expressions are derived for evaluation when the effects of in-phase/quadrature(I/Q) imbalance is concerned. Several simulation results shown subsequently demonstrate that the existence of these imperfections brings an even bigger problem than in their traditional single antenna counterparts. All the work provides a theoretical foundation of the practical multi-antenna wireless communication systems for engineers and designers.
